The Avenue Marius Renard 27 ( Dutch : Marius Renardlaan 27 ) is a residential tower in Anderlecht , a municipality in the Belgian capital, Brussels . The building is located in close proximity to Astridpark and the Great Ring , a 75 km long city motorway around Brussels.

The building is 85 meters high and has 30 floors. It was completed in 1971, making it one of the first buildings in Belgium to exceed the 80 meter mark. It is currently the third tallest residential tower in Brussels after the Up-site and the Brusilia and is also one of the tallest buildings in the city and the country .

A major renovation has recently been carried out on the building.
